Output 00518e3bd0c735b44427d16d3c2f05c599667434b1bb1d5bb4fb37dbc5fdb0b7:2

value
44465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cdab6f1b8b9afa907b7eafedbae78262be5fa26 OP_EQUAL
address
3D5BitY1dTCxVregEDeFu5W4LTmyavgE6Z
transaction
00518e3bd0c735b44427d16d3c2f05c599667434b1bb1d5bb4fb37dbc5fdb0b7
confirmations
195025
spent
true